Subject: Re: [PATCH net-next 08/11] tun: switch to new type of msg_control
Date: Fri, 7 Sep 2018 11:35:13 +0800 [thread overview]
Message-ID: <4141e1c0-618a-978f-0188-7bebeb2c4e70@redhat.com> (raw)
In-Reply-To: <20180906125051-mutt-send-email-mst@kernel.org>
On 2018年09月07日 00:54, Michael S. Tsirkin wrote:
> On Thu, Sep 06, 2018 at 12:05:23PM +0800, Jason Wang wrote:
>> This patch introduces to a new tun/tap specific msg_control:
>>
>> #define TUN_MSG_UBUF 1
>> #define TUN_MSG_PTR 2
>> struct tun_msg_ctl {
>> int type;
>> void *ptr;
>> };
>>
>> This allows us to pass different kinds of msg_control through
>> sendmsg(). The first supported type is ubuf (TUN_MSG_UBUF) which will
>> be used by the existed vhost_net zerocopy code. The second is XDP
>> buff, which allows vhost_net to pass XDP buff to TUN. This could be
>> used to implement accepting an array of XDP buffs from vhost_net in
>> the following patches.
>>
>> Signed-off-by: Jason Wang <jasowang@redhat.com>
> At this point, do we want to just add a new sock opt for tap's
> benefit? Seems cleaner than (ab)using sendmsg.
I think it won't be much difference, we still need a void pointer.

>> +#define TUN_MSG_UBUF 1
>> +#define TUN_MSG_PTR 2
> Looks like TUN_MSG_PTR should be pushed out to a follow-up patch?
Ok.
>
>> +struct tun_msg_ctl {
>> + int type;
>> + void *ptr;
>> +};
>> +
> type actually includes a size. Why not two short fields then?
Yes, this sounds better.
Thanks
